Blast is a Layer 2 network on Ethereum that not only scales transactions with optimistic rollups but also automatically generates native yield on bridged ETH and stablecoins. By integrating staking and DeFi yield strategies directly into the network, Blast offers users a seamless way to earn passive income without complex setups.

Blast is an Ethereum Layer 2 scaling solution that's designed with a clear purpose: to help users earn passive income through native yield mechanisms. Unlike traditional L2 networks that focus solely on reducing gas fees and increasing transaction speeds, Blast adds another dimension by automatically generating returns on your deposited ETH and stablecoins.

Key point: Blast differentiates itself by being the first Layer 2 solution that automatically provides native yield to its users.

As an EVM-compatible network, Blast maintains compatibility with Ethereum's infrastructure while solving some of its most pressing challenges—high gas fees and scaling limitations.

How Blast Works: The Technical Foundation

Blast operates using optimistic rollup technology, which bundles multiple transactions off-chain before submitting them to the Ethereum mainnet as a single transaction. This approach significantly reduces gas fees while maintaining Ethereum's security guarantees.

Here's what makes Blast's technical architecture unique:

  • It uses an auto rebasing mechanism that automatically distributes ETH staking rewards
  • The protocol bridges your assets to generate yield without requiring any additional steps
  • Gas fee revenue sharing provides an additional income stream for users
  • Smart contracts automatically convert non-yielding ETH into yielding ETH

For the average user, this means your crypto isn't just sitting idle—it's working for you, similar to how interest works in traditional banking (but potentially with higher returns).

The Native Yield Advantage: How Users Benefit

The most distinctive feature of Blast is its native yield functionality. Here's how it works for different assets:

For ETH holders:

When you bridge ETH to Blast, it's automatically staked through Lido (a popular ETH staking service). Currently, this generates around 4% annual yield—automatically added to your balance without requiring any extra steps from you.

For stablecoin holders:

Stablecoins like USDC and DAI deposited on Blast are automatically deployed to proven DeFi protocols, currently generating approximately 5% in annual yields.

Key point: Your assets automatically earn returns on Blast without requiring you to navigate complex DeFi protocols.

This native yield approach eliminates the typical complexities of yield farming in decentralized finance (DeFi), making passive income accessible to crypto beginners and veterans alike.

Blast vs. Other Layer 2 Solutions: What Sets It Apart

The Ethereum scaling ecosystem is getting crowded, so what makes Blast different from Optimism, Arbitrum, or Base?

Native yield generation: While other L2s focus solely on scaling, Blast adds automatic yield.

Simplified experience: Many DeFi platforms require multiple transactions and complicated steps to earn yield. Blast eliminates this friction.

Points program: Blast rewards early users with points that may convert to tokens in an airdrop.

Gas revenue sharing: Unlike some competitors, Blast shares gas fee revenue with users rather than keeping it all for the protocol.

The total value locked (TVL) in Blast has grown impressively since its launch, indicating strong user adoption despite being a newcomer in the space.

Who's Behind Blast?

Blast was founded by Pacman (Tieshun Roquerre), who previously created the NFT marketplace Blur. This connection has lent credibility to the project, as Blur successfully established itself in the competitive NFT marketplace landscape.

The team behind Blast includes experienced developers from various successful blockchain projects, which has helped build trust within the crypto community.

Getting Started with Blast: A Simple Guide

If you're interested in using Blast, here's how to get started:

  • Create a Web3 wallet (like MetaMask) if you don't already have one
  • Visit the official Blast website and connect your wallet
  • Bridge your ETH or stablecoins from Ethereum mainnet to the Blast network
  • Your assets will automatically begin generating yield
  • Monitor your growing balance directly in your wallet

Important safety tip: Always verify you're on the official Blast website before connecting your wallet or transferring funds.

Remember that while the bridging process may involve gas fees, the long-term yield potential often outweighs these initial costs, especially for larger deposits.

Potential Risks and Considerations

While Blast offers compelling benefits, it's important to consider the potential risks:

  • As a newer L2 solution, Blast hasn't been battle-tested as long as some competitors
  • Smart contract risks exist with any blockchain protocol
  • Yields may fluctuate based on market conditions
  • Bridging assets back to Ethereum mainnet involves a waiting period

Always research thoroughly and consider diversifying your crypto investments across different platforms to manage risk effectively.
